Which dehumidifier should I hire for damp and mould?

For a cold or unheated room, choose a unit suited to cool spaces and matched to the room size. Skip the little moisture absorbers — they're too small for a genuinely damp room in Bradfield St Clare.

Will it push my electricity bill up?

Running costs stay modest: a domestic unit often runs a few hours a day thanks to the built-in humidistat, which switches it off once the target humidity is reached.

How long until I see a difference in Bradfield St Clare?

It depends how wet things are: a damp room clears in days, while drying-out works in Bradfield St Clare may need a week or more of continuous running.

Will a dehumidifier get rid of black mould?

Yes, indirectly — mould thrives on damp air. Keep things dry and you break the cycle. For heavy growth, treat the surface first, then dry the room.
